Dungarpur District, Rajasthan
Dungarpur District is an administrative district in the state of Rajasthan, India. It is situated about 410 km from Jaipur, the state capital of Rajasthan. The district headquarters is located at Dungarpur. Hindi, Wagri and Bhili are the main languages spoken in the district. The district covers a total geographical area of 3,770 km², including 3,743.30 km² of rural area and 26.70 km² of urban area.
List of Tehsils in Dungarpur District
Dungarpur District is divided into 13 Tehsils for administrative and revenue purposes. In total, there are 1,047 villages under these tehsils. The table below lists each tehsil along with village count and geographical area.
| Sl. No. | Tehsil | Villages | Area (km²) |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| Aspur | 94 | 710.27 |
| 2 | Bichhiwara | 71 | — |
| 3 | Chikhali | 86 | — |
| 4 | Dovda | 97 | — |
| 5 | Dungarpur | 99 | 1,318.56 |
| 6 | Galiyakot | 62 | — |
| 7 | Gamri Ahara | 36 | — |
| 8 | Jhonthripal | 62 | — |
| 9 | Obri | 45 | — |
| 10 | Paldewal | 27 | — |
| 11 | Sabla | 102 | — |
| 12 | Sagwara | 148 | 877.72 |
| 13 | Simalwara | 118 | 863.44 |
Population of Dungarpur District
As per the Census 2011, Dungarpur District has a total population of 13,88,552 people, consisting of 6,96,532 males and 6,92,020 females. There are 2,82,029 households in the district with an average population density of 368 people per km². The table below shows the rural and urban breakup of population and households:
| Particulars | Total | Rural | Urban |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Population | 13,88,552 | 12,99,809 | 88,743 |
| Male Population | 6,96,532 | 6,51,046 | 45,486 |
| Female Population | 6,92,020 | 6,48,763 | 43,257 |
| Total Households | 2,82,029 | 2,63,075 | 18,954 |
| Population Density | 368 / km² | 347 / km² | 3,324 / km² |
Beyond these basic counts, the district has 6,81,591 literate people and 2,42,239 children (0–6 years). The demographic distribution also includes 52,267 from Scheduled Caste (SC) and 9,83,437 from Scheduled Tribe (ST) communities. Detailed rural and urban data for these categories is provided below:
| Particulars | Total | Rural | Urban |
|---|---|---|---|
| Child Population (Age 0–6) | 2,42,239 | 2,31,406 | 10,833 |
| Literate Population | 6,81,591 | 6,15,851 | 65,740 |
| Illiterate Population | 7,06,961 | 6,83,958 | 23,003 |
| Scheduled Caste (SC) Population | 52,267 | 44,309 | 7,958 |
| Scheduled Tribe (ST) Population | 9,83,437 | 9,67,086 | 16,351 |
NOTE: Population and area figures shown here are based on Census 2011. Administrative boundaries may have changed, so the figures may include combined values for areas that were reorganized later.
